> A couple of corrections. The contest starts at
>1800 UTC and goes for 24 hours, unless you start setting up at 1800 UTC,
>then you can operate for 27 hours. See info below:
>
>
>3. Date and Time Period: Field Day is always the fourth full weekend of June, beginning at 1800 UTC Saturday and ending at 2100 UTC Sunday. Field Day 2003 will be held June 28-29, 2003.
>
>3.1. Class A and B (see below) stations that do not begin setting up until 1800 UTC on Saturday may operate the entire Field Day period.
>
>3.2. Stations who begin setting up before 1800 UTC Saturday may work only 24 consecutive hours, commencing when on-the-air operations begin.
>
>3.3. No Class A or B station may begin their set-up earlier than 1800 UTC on the Friday preceding the contest period.
